WebJul 29, 2024 · Infant rates will usually be under 220 beats per minute and children under 180 beats per minute. Sinus tachycardia should be treated by searching for the underlying cause and treating it accordingly. Supraventricular tachycardia (SVT) is a heart rate of ≥ 220 for infants and ≥ 180 for children. WebOct 17, 2024 · Supraventricular tachycardia (SVT) is a common non-arrest dysrhythmia seen in children, especially during infancy, and is the main cause of cardiac-related instability. Most infants with SVT will outgrow the syndrome without lasting effects. History of the complaint is the key to proper distinction between SVT and rapid sinus tachycardia.
